Gee, It Didn't Look This Way on Paper

A quote from a natural-food start-up president warning against allowing green MBAs access to large amounts of capital.

 

"Should you hand a bunch of capital to green M.B.A.'s? No. Because in the typical business-school model, entrepreneurs raise a ton of money, lose a lot of it, eventually break even, and then start making money. But in the real world, there's an enormous amount you just can't anticipate. And it's really disconcerting when your bank account is going down rapidly." -- J. J. Mullane, former green M.B.A. and president of TerraVera, a natural-foods start-up in Redwood City, Calif.
